JavaScript中7种常见删除数组中指定元素的方法(含代码) 在 JavaScript 中,数组是一种常用的数据结构,常常需要删除数组中指定的元素。以下是七种常见的方法来删除数组中的特定元素,并附带代码示例,供你参考。1. 使用 splice() 方法splice() 方法可以从数组中添加或删除元素。我们可以先找到要删除的元素的索引,然后使用 splice 后端 2024年10月01日 0 点赞 0 评论 21 浏览
两小时快速入门 TypeScript 基础(一)工作流、基本类型、高级类型 两小时快速入门 TypeScript 基础(一)工作流、基本类型、高级类型一、什么是 TypeScript?TypeScript 是一种由微软开发的开源编程语言,是 JavaScript 的超集,主要增加了静态类型和基于类的面向对象编程的特性。TypeScript 的存在旨在提高 JavaScr 前端 2024年10月13日 0 点赞 0 评论 25 浏览
pc端web网站使用第三方微信登录流程(web、js) 在现代互联网应用中,第三方登录已经成为一种流行的用户认证方式。微信作为中国最大的社交平台之一,其登录功能被广泛应用于各种网站和应用中。本文将介绍如何在PC端Web网站中使用第三方微信登录的流程,并给出相应的代码示例。一、准备工作注册应用:首先,你需要在微信开放平台注册一个应用,获取到AppI 前端 2024年09月26日 0 点赞 0 评论 70 浏览
JavaScript map对象/set对象详解 JavaScript 中的 Map 和 Set 对象是 ES6 引入的两个重要数据结构,它们提供了更灵活和高效的方式来存储和管理数据。接下来,我将详细介绍这两个对象,并给出一些代码示例。一、Map 对象Map 是一种键值对的集合,其中每个键都与一个值相对应。与普通对象不同,Map 允许使用任何类 后端 2024年09月25日 0 点赞 0 评论 19 浏览
URL.createObjectURL 与 FileReader:Web 文件处理两大法宝的对比 在Web开发中,处理文件是一个常见的需求。随着HTML5的普及,开发者有了更多的工具来处理用户上传的文件。URL.createObjectURL和FileReader是两种使用广泛的API,它们在文件处理上各有优劣。本文将对这两者进行对比,并给出具体的代码示例。一、基本概念URL.create 前端 2024年10月15日 0 点赞 0 评论 28 浏览
聊一聊前后端权限控制 RBAC(完整流程) RBAC(基于角色的访问控制)前后端权限控制完整流程RBAC(Role-Based Access Control)是一种基于角色的权限控制机制,通过为用户分配角色,管理这些角色的权限,来实现对资源访问的有效管理。在现代的Web应用中,前后端分离已经成为主流架构,因此对前后端的权限控制进行有效管理显 前端 2024年10月02日 0 点赞 0 评论 19 浏览
【油猴脚本】00018 案例 Tampermonkey油猴脚本, 仅用于学习,不要乱搞。继续优化UI界面,Jquery爬虫,JavaScript爬虫,HTML+Css+JavaScript编写 使用Tampermonkey优化网页界面Tampermonkey是一款非常流行的浏览器扩展,允许用户自定义和修改网页内容。借助于Tampermonkey,用户可以使用JavaScript、jQuery等工具编写用户脚本来优化网页的用户界面(UI),实现一些特定的需求。下面,我们将讨论如何利用Tam 后端 2024年10月02日 0 点赞 0 评论 78 浏览
前端 Web 性能清单 前端 Web 性能清单在现代网页开发中,性能优化是至关重要的一环。网页的加载速度不仅影响用户体验,还会直接影响网站的转化率和搜索引擎排名。为了帮助开发者提升前端性能,本文列出了一些实用的性能优化建议,并通过代码示例进行具体说明。1. 减少 HTTP 请求每个 HTTP 请求都会消耗时间,因此我 前端 2024年10月20日 0 点赞 0 评论 26 浏览
signature_pad 库详解 signature_pad 是一个轻量级的 JavaScript 库,用于在网页上实现手写签名功能。这个库特别适合需要捕获用户手写签名的应用场景,如在线合同签署、用户注册等。它使用 Canvas API 绘制手写签名,因此可以在各种现代浏览器上运行良好。同时,signature_pad 可以方便地将 前端 2024年10月21日 0 点赞 0 评论 69 浏览
Vue项目中实现AES加密解密 在现代Web开发中,数据安全是一个非常重要的话题,尤其是在前后端分离的架构中。AES(高级加密标准)是一种广泛使用的对称加密算法,可以有效保护敏感数据。在这篇文章中,我们将讨论如何在Vue项目中实现AES加密和解密,并提供代码示例。一、准备工作在开始之前,需要确保你的项目中安装了crypto-j 前端 2024年09月24日 0 点赞 0 评论 75 浏览